8-20-030
Definitions.
* * *
(i) "Assault ammunition" means any ammunition magazine having a capacity of more than twelve (12) rounds of ammunition.
8-24-025
Assault weapons or ammunition--Sale prohibited-- Exceptions. (a) No person shall sell, offer or display for sale, give, lend, transfer ownership of, acquire or possess any assault weapon
or assault ammunition, as those terms are defined in Chapter 8-20 of this Code. This section shall not apply to any officer, agent, or employee of this or any other municipality or state or of the United States, members of the armed forces of the United States, or the organized militia of this or any other state, and peace officers as defined in this Code to the extent that any such pers on is otherwise authorized to acquire or possess an assault weapon or assault ammunition and is acting within the scope of his or her duties. In addition, this section shall not apply to the acquisition or possession of assault ammunition by persons employed to provide security for armored carriers or mobile check cashing services while in the course of such duties, while commuting directly to or from the person's place of employment, and while at the person's home, if the assault ammunition (1) is acquired or possessed for use with a weapon that the person has been authorized to carry under Section 28 of the Illinois Private Detective, Private Alarm and Private Security Act of 1983; and (2) consists of an ammunition magazine that has a capacity of 15 or fewer rounds of ammunition.
(b) Any assault weapon or assault ammunition possessed, sold or transferred in violation of subsection (a) is hereby declared to be contraband and shall be seized and disposed of in accordance with the provisions of Section 8-20-220.
(c) Any person found in violation of this section shall be sentenced to not more than six months imprisonment or fined not less than $500.00 and not more than $1,000.00 or both.
(d) Any person who, prior to the effective date of the ordinance codified in this section, was legally in possession of an assault weapon or assault ammunition prohibited by this section shall have 14 days from the effective date of the ordinance codified in this section to do any of the following without being subject to prosecution hereunder:
(1) To remove the assault weapon or ammunition from within the limits of the City of Chicago; or
(2) To modify the assault weapon either to render it permanently inoperable or to permanently make it a device no longer defined as an assault weapon; or
(3) To surrender the assault weapon or ammunition to the superintendent of police or his designee for disposal in accordance with Section 8-20-220.
(Added Coun. J. 7-7-92, p. 19196; Amend Coun. J. 7-29-92, p. 20068; Amend Coun. J. 9-14-94, p. 56287)
8-20-160 Possession of ammunition.
No person shall possess ammunition in the City of Chicago unless:
(a) He is a person exempted pursuant to Section 8-20-040 of this chapter; or
(b) He is the holder of a valid registration certificate for a firearm of the same gauge or caliber as the ammunition possessed, and has the registration certificate in his possession while in possession of the ammunition; or
(c) He is a licensed weapons dealer pursuant to Chapter 4-144 or a licensed shooting gallery or gun club pursuant to Chapter 4-149 of this Code.
(Prior code § 11.1-14; Amend Coun. J. 9-14-94, p. 56287)
4-144-061
Sale of certain handgun ammunition prohibited.
Except as allowed by subsection (e) of Section 8-20-170 of this Code, it shall be unlawful for any person to sell, offer for sale, expose for sale, barter or give away to any person within the city, any ammunition of the following calibers and types:
.45 automatic
.380 automatic
.38 special
.357 magnum
.25 caliber
.22 caliber, including .22 long
9 millimeter
Any other ammunition, regardless of the designation by the manufacturer, distributor or seller, that is capable of being used as a substitute for any of the foregoing.
(Added Coun. J. 9-14-94, p. 56287)
